What is the PMS and PMDD Symptoms Tracking Chart?

The PMS and PMDD Symptoms Tracking Chart serves as a valuable tool for individuals to monitor and document symptoms related to Premenstrual Syndrome (PMS) and Premenstrual Dysphoric Disorder (PMDD) over the course of their menstrual cycle. This chart helps track emotional and physical symptoms on a daily basis, promoting awareness and understanding of one's health. Users can fill out various sections that include checkboxes for specific symptoms, making it easier to identify patterns and triggers throughout their cycle.

Purpose and Benefits of the PMS and PMDD Symptoms Tracking Chart

The primary purpose of the PMS and PMDD Symptoms Tracking Chart is to aid individuals in identifying and monitoring symptoms across their menstrual cycles. By consistently tracking symptoms, users can gain insights into their health, which can significantly enhance discussions with healthcare providers. Regular monitoring helps with:
  • Identifying symptom patterns and triggers
  • Improving health conversations with medical professionals
  • Documenting changes over time for better treatment planning

Preparing for Your Consultation with the PMS and PMDD Symptoms Tracking Chart

To maximize the benefits of your healthcare consultation, it’s essential to prepare effectively. Gather the following information before your visit:
  • Complete records of your symptoms logged in the chart
  • Specific concerns or questions regarding your symptoms
  • Any previous treatments and their effects
